What is Fossil Group's net debt / EBITDA?
Fossil Group (FOSL) reported net debt / EBITDA of 24.4× in Q1 2026.
What does net debt / EBITDA mean?
Net debt (total debt minus cash) divided by trailing-twelve-month EBITDA. Expresses leverage in years — roughly how long it would take to repay net debt out of operating cash earnings.
